Ahrend Walters, the Believer Poet, knows God has gifted him with great creativity. He expresses this creativity through dynamic and unusual poetry. He knows that none of his poetry is perfect. In fact, he purposely does little revision and leaves in flaws of grammar or spelling. This is not to show he doesn't care. Rather, he is demonstrating that as a creative genius his talent is still imperfect unless he points to Jesus Christ and lets Christ express through him the Truth and perfection that comes from God. So, he is writing what flows through him and he is on a mission to show others that even in their flaws they can express the Truth if they dedicate their work to the Lord.
